Kelli and her family went to the beach for a vacation. They drove 293 miles in 7 hours to get there. ABOUT how many miles did th
12345 [234]

Answer:

41.86 miles each hour

Step-by-step explanation:

Kelli and her family went to the beach for a vacation. They drove 293 miles in 7 hours to get there. ABOUT how many miles did they drive each hour?

This Question is calculated as:

7 hours = 293 miles

1 hour = x miles

Cross Multiply

7 hours × x = 1 × 293 miles

x = 293 miles/7 hours

x = 41.857142857 miles per hour

x ≈ 41.86 miles per hour

Hence, they drove 41.86 miles each hour
